The biggest new trend in handguns is the miniature red dot sight. While we've been scoping hunting handguns for some time now, the reliable (?) miniature red dot is going to take handguns into the next level, just like it did for certain rifles.

The only big prohibition at present is cost. To get a good one costs as much as the gun. Another aspect is bulk and size, but their working on that. For me, to be able to see handgun sights, and shoot a pistol well as I did 15 years ago, I'll tolerate a bit of bulk and weight, .....but not too much. I'm already seeing occasional dot sights on duty handguns, and new guns like the assorted Glocks and others, come w/ the slide optic ready.
